1

Pest Manage castle hill

News Discuss 
How Pest Handle Specialists Aid Castle Hill Citizens and Companies Pest control Castle Hill pest call industry experts are very important allies while in the fight against damaging pests. No matter if safeguarding residential or professional Homes, these experts produce thorough pest Manage products and services tailor-made to every residence’s https://bookmarkedblog.com/story17686543/pest-regulate-castle-hill

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story